Adobe is starting to convert the hoary old Adobe Exchanges into a sleek new set of Adobe Marketplaces.
Adobe Exchange: http://tr.im/adobeexchange
Adobe Marketplace: http://tr.im/adobemplace
Like Apple's App store, which provides iPhone and iPod owners a one-stop location to browse and buy third-party applications, the Adobe Marketplace will be a venue for Adobe customers to do the same.
more >When you save an Illustrator CS4 file with multiple artboards in native Illustrator CS4 format, the file extension is still plain old ".ai".
Earlier versions of Illustrator can open the AI file, but users will get the cryptic alert "This file was created in a newer version of Illustrator. If you import this file, some data loss may occur." When they open the file, they'll see only one artboard, the one that was labelled "1" in the original file. There is NO indication that there's a bunch of artwork missing from missing artboards.
